Answer:
Part 1) The original triangle ΔJKL has the bigger area
Part 2)
Step-by-step explanation:
Part 1) Which triangle has a bigger area?
we know that
A dilation is a non rigid transformation that produce similar figures
If two figures are similar, then the ratio of its corresponding sides is proportional and its corresponding angles are congruent
In this problem
ΔJKL is similar to ΔWXY
The scale factor is 3/4
3/4 < 1
That means ---->The dilation is a reduction
therefore
The original triangle ΔJKL has the bigger area
